Chhattisgarh: Driver hurt as empty pax train engine hits fallen tree and derails

Due to incessant rainfall in the area, a banyan tree had fallen which the locomotive hit and its two front wheels were derailed

The engine of an empty Antagrah-bound passenger train was derailed after it hit a giant tree that had fallen on the track in Chhattisgarh's Kanker district on Friday. The loco pilot suffered minor injuries, officials said repored PTI.

The incident took place in the early hours of Friday between Bhanupratappur and Gudum villages. As per the PTI report, the empty DEMU passenger train was heading to Antagarh (Kanker district) from Dallirajhara (Balod district), a railway official said.
